In 1964, Kitty Genovese was brutally stabbed to death in front of her apartment building. Police reports showed that although mo
Brut [27]

Answer:

the bystander effect

Explanation:

The bystander effect is the social psychological phenomenon that occurs when individuals are less likely to intervene to help someone in an emergency. The greater the number of observer present at the site of a situation, the less likely would be a probability of helping hand. In contrast to this people would react more likely when there no or few witnessed present. There are many reasons recorded-for this effect like ambiguity, diffusion of responsibility, cultural difference, etc.

There are____total electors in the electoral college. A candidate needs____to win the presidency.
qaws [65]

There are 538 total electors in the electoral college. A candidate needs 270 to win the presidency. The electoral College consists on the meeting of the electors that vote for President and Vice President and the counting of the electoral votes. The electoral college system was established by the founding fathers.
